Choosing A Webhost:
A web hosting service is a type of Internet hosting service that allows individuals and organizations to provide their own website accessible via the World Wide Web. Web hosts are companies that provide space on a server they own for use by their clients as well as providing Internet connectivity, typically in a data center. Web hosts can also provide data center space and connectivity to the Internet for servers they do not own to be located in their data center, called colocation. more...

Call for Papers

Concurrent Engineering (CE) is widely known as an effective product development
approach. Its major objective is to reduce the system/product development time
and effort through a better integration of activities and processes. As defined
by the US
Institute for Defense Analyses (IDA), CE is the systematic approach to the
integrated, concurrent design of products and related processes, including
manufacturing and support throughout the whole product life cycle from
conception to disposal.

CE methodology becomes even more attractive today and in the future when the
procedures and the technologies of design and manufacturing become more
globalized, standardized, dynamic and flexible. The challenge for the future
generation of CE
methodologies and infrastructures is the provision of the solutions for
automated rational interoperation among independent human and artificial
team-players in open organizations. The appearance of virtual enterprises,
consortia as temporary coalitions in
design and manufacturing make CE activities and processes globally dispersed
organizationally and geographically. Another big task for CE methodology is to
properly and effectively guide the assembly of a design or a production process
from matching
distributed service components. The services are evidently provided by
independent parties and possess varying availability and price over time. The
facet of reputation and trust among the members of these open dynamic
constellations of economically rational agents is of extreme importance as well.

The agent paradigm has proved its capability to provide successful solutions
for the application areas where autonomous, loosely-coupled, heterogeneous, and
distributed systems or players need to rationally interoperate in order to
achieve a common
goal. Ontologies are recognized as shared common specifications of the concepts
used for interoperation in open heterogeneous systems of autonomous rational
agents. It is topical that both Agents and Ontologies are central to the
rapidly emerging Semantic
Web. Their combined use will enable the sharing of heterogeneous, autonomous
knowledge on services, service providers, service capabilities in a scalable,
adaptable and extensible manner in frame of the Semantic Web of Services.

The focus of CE'2003 is 'The vision for the future generation'. Following this,
we solicit research and profound visionary papers providing for better
understanding of and forming the emerging landscape of (semi-)automated
knowledge sharing models,
methodologies, solutions and infrastructures in agent-enabled CE.
